Bandwidth is improved because, instead of transferring all of the vertex data for a high-polygon mesh
•
over the PCI-E bus, we only supply the coarse mesh to the GPU. At render time, the GPU will need to
fetch only this mesh data, yielding higher utilization of vertex cache and fetch performance. The
tessellator directly generates new data which is immediately consumed by the GPU, without additional
storage in memory.
